WebIn 1860. Tyler B. Henry invented the Henry repeating rifle prior to the civil war. The metallic case of the cartridge could effectively seal the breech of the gun to contain the hot propellent gases. This way, the firing pin would strike the rim without hitting it. The 44 Henry cartridge was comparable in power with some military pistols. There was a reason amputations were streamlined during the war — and it was not because the... 2. … randall mathison ohio state universityWebMar 26, 2024 · At the outbreak of the Civil War, warship design was just beginning to incorporate steam power. Most vessels were still wooden and powered by sail, but the British and French started to add armor-plating the sides of existing ship designs. From the beginning of the war, both the Union and the Confederacy sought to acquire ironclad … randall martin wustlWebThe Civil War was the first "modern" war, in terms of its weaponry. Torpedoes, land mines, machine guns, ironclad ships all made their first appearance in the 1860s. But technological advances that helped determine the war's outcome went beyond military innovations.
